1. Meetings Africa 2025
Date: February 25–26, 2025
Location: Sandton Convention Centre, Johannesburg, South Africa
Meetings Africa 2025 serves as a premier platform showcasing Africa’s diverse range of services and products. The event is designed to facilitate pre-scheduled appointments through a targeted matchmaking program, enabling participants to engage with local corporate executives and international buyers. Attendees can also benefit from seminars featuring industry experts and motivational speakers, enhancing their understanding of the business events industry. (meetingsafrica.co.za)

3. Experience Africa 2025
Date: June 23–25, 2025
Location: 155 Bishopsgate, London, United Kingdom
Organized by the African Travel and Tourism Association (ATTA), Experience Africa 2025 is a premier platform uniting suppliers from across the continent with active buyers from the UK, Europe, and other international destinations. The event offers strategic networking opportunities and a market for buyers and sellers aiming to expand their Africa-focused travel offerings. Participants can engage in pre-scheduled appointments, fostering new partnerships and driving business growth. (eabyatta.eventsair.com)
4. Engage Trade Africa 2025
Date: October 27–30, 2025
Location: International Convention Centre, Durban, South Africa
Engage Trade Africa (ETA) is a specialized Hosted Buyer Engagement Program designed to foster lasting relationships through a variety of activities over its four-day duration. The event facilitates trade between Africa and the global market by connecting African producers with leading international buyers and partners. Through strategic B2B matchmaking, ETA drives meaningful partnerships, promotes industry growth, and supports the advancement of Africa’s economy. (quicket.co.za)
5. Ambition Africa 2025
Date: November 18–21, 2025
Location: Ministry of Economy, Finance and Industrial and Digital Sovereignty, Paris, France
Under the high patronage of the President of the Republic Emmanuel Macron, Ambition Africa 2025 will feature a plenary session, various sectoral round tables, and qualified B2B meetings. The event aims to strengthen economic ties between Africa and France, providing a platform for business delegations, ministers, experts, and key-note speakers to engage in discussions and networking opportunities. 6. GITEX Africa 2025
Date: April 14–16, 2025
Location: Marrakesh, Morocco
GITEX Africa is an annual technology exhibition and conference that convenes technology leaders, innovators, startups, and policymakers to advance digital transformation across the African continent. The 2025 edition is expected to be the largest yet, spotlighting the continent’s progress in AI, connectivity, and digital finance. The event anticipates participation from over 400 investors managing $250 billion in assets across more than 35 countries, alongside tech leaders and corporate buyers. (en.wikipedia.org)
